Ahmed I. El‐Diwany is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Biotechnology and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Ahmed I. El‐Diwany has authored 56 papers receiving a total of 883 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 28 papers in Molecular Biology, 27 papers in Biotechnology and 16 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Ahmed I. El‐Diwany's work include Enzyme Production and Characterization (19 papers), Microbial Natural Products and Biosynthesis (12 papers) and Biofuel production and bioconversion (12 papers). Ahmed I. El‐Diwany is often cited by papers focused on Enzyme Production and Characterization (19 papers), Microbial Natural Products and Biosynthesis (12 papers) and Biofuel production and bioconversion (12 papers). Ahmed I. El‐Diwany collaborates with scholars based in Egypt, Germany and Australia. Ahmed I. El‐Diwany's co-authors include Mohamed A. Farid, Hesham Ali El Enshasy, Khaled A. Selim, A. El-Shafei, Ahmed A. El‐Beih, Dina E. El-Ghwas, A. M. A. Nada, Altaf H. Basta, Houssni El‐Saied and Tahany M. A. Abdel-Rahman and has published in prestigious journals such as Bioresource Technology,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ology and Journal of Applied Polymer Science.
